Originally Posted by 2016BoostedGreyGoose
Damn, and I thought I was pushing it with 24's.....lol
I measured the fender to tire gap, and I have 5/5.5". So 3/5 will go easy. I plan on ridin that for a few weeks, let it settle, and see how I like it. See if there's any rubbing while turning into driveways or anything. If everything's ok, I'll push it to 4/6. That would be as low as I go on 26's though.
